Responsibilities:
· Build high-performance distributed applications using asynchronous programming techniques in . This includes UI components and web APIs that work with MySQL backend.
· Troubleshoot and debug existing code to fix bugs.
· Understand business requirements from stake-holders and refine them for implementation.
· Participate in sprint and design meetings.
· Work with other developers to integrate front-end components and other backend APIs to improve existing system.
· Create unit test cases necessary for TDD.
· Work with QA team to help create detailed test plans.
· Optimize, reengineer non-performant parts of existing system.
· Create technical documentation.
· Perform code reviews.
· Work with code repository like GitHub to manage source code.
Requirements:
· Bachelors Degree (Masters preferred) in Computer Science or related technical field.
· Demonstrated experience in and API development. Over all 6-8 years of experience in a web-application development in environment
· Good understanding of Data Structures and Algorithms.
· Knowledge of industry standard code repositories like SVN, Git, etc.
· Experience with database technologies like MySQL, Oracle, SQL Server, etc.
· Attention to detail.
Strong knowledge of:
· , , JavaScript, HTML5, CSS3 and how the web works
· REST API, CRUD paradigm, JSON, XML
· Web authentication and security (like encryption, hashes, OAuth, OAuth2 and JWT tokens)
· SQL/RDBMS querying, stored procedures, indexes, subqueries
· Workings of and asynchronous programming
· ecosystem including libraries like , Redis, filesystem, and others
· Testing using tools like Postman, Chai, and Joi validation
· Principles of computer science, software development and software engineering practices
· Knowledge of low-latency, high-availability server-side programming
· Optimization, profiling and debugging backend services a
Experience
2 - 7 Years
No. of Openings
5
Education
B.Ed, B.Sc, B.E, M.B.A/PGDM, M.Sc, Company Secretary
Role
NODE JS Developer
Industry Type
IT-Hardware & Networking / IT-Software / Software Services
Gender
[ Male / Female ]
Job Country
India
Type of Job
Full Time
Work Location Type
Work from Office